I discussed 12 strategies one by one: how each works, who should consider it, and the mistakes to avoid.
Strategy 1: Choosing the right entity (LLC vs S Corp)
Strategy 2: Estimated taxes without the year-end surprise
Strategy 3: Accountable plan (mileage, home office, cell phone)
Strategy 4: Self-employed health insurance deduction
Strategy 5: HSA - the triple tax advantage
Strategy 6: Accelerated depreciation (Section 179, vehicles)
Strategy 7: Board of advisors + the Augusta rule
Strategy 8: Don't miss your spouse's employer match
Strategy 9: Roth vs traditional retirement accounts
Strategy 10: The right retirement plan for your business
Strategy 11: PTET election (state tax workaround)
Strategy 12: Hiring family members the right way
